Comprehending Hobs: Types and Features
Hobs are flat cooking surfaces that include one or more burners utilized for cooking. They are available in various types, each with its own functions and advantages. Here are the primary kinds of hobs readily available in the market today:
-
Gas Hobs:
- Use gas as fuel, providing instant heat and precise temperature level control.
- Typically chosen by expert chefs for their responsiveness.
-
Electric Hobs:
- Include conventional coil burners and smooth ceramic or glass surface areas.
- Offers constant heat and is easier to clean than gas hobs.
-
Induction Hobs:
- Use electro-magnetic energy to heat pots and pans directly.
- More energy-efficient and more secure, as they remain cool to the touch.
-
Hybrid Hobs:
- Combine both gas and induction features.
- Permit users to switch between gas and induction cooking as required.
Type of Hob
Advantages
Disadvantages
Gas
Instantaneous heat, exact control
Setup needs gas line
Electric
Consistent heating, easy to clean
Slower heating procedure
Induction
Energy-efficient, much safer cooking
Needs compatible cookware
Hybrid
Versatile, adaptable to user preferences
Normally more expensive

Purchasing Guide: Choosing the Right Hob
With a lot of alternatives available, choosing the right hob can be intimidating. Here are some essential factors to consider to keep in mind:
1. Cooking Style:
- Assess cooking habits and choices. For example, those who choose quick cooking may lean towards induction hobs, whereas traditionalists might favor gas.
2. Kitchen Space:
- Evaluate the offered kitchen space. Is there enough space for a larger hob, or would a compact design be better?
3. Installation Type:
- Determine if your kitchen has the essential energies for gas or if a plug-in electric model is better.
4. Security Features:
- Look for hobs with advanced safety features, particularly if there are children in the household.
5. Budget:
- Establish a budget, keeping in mind that while some hobs might have a higher initial expense, they might offer better energy performance and longevity, resulting in long-lasting cost savings.

Regularly Asked Questions
1. What are the main distinctions between gas and induction hobs?Gas hobs supply instant heat and temperature control, while induction hobs are more energy-efficient and cook quicker as they heat up the cookware straight.
2. Are induction hobs safe for homes with children?Yes, induction hobs frequently feature built-in safety functions like automatic shut-off and cool surface areas that make them a more secure option for homes with kids.
3. Can I use any pots and pans on an induction hob?Induction hobs need ferrous (magnetic) cookware. Always examine if your pots and pans work before acquiring an induction cooking system.
4. Are wise hobs worth the financial investment?Smart hobs can be an excellent financial investment for tech-savvy users who value push-button control functionalities and energy management options.
5. How do I keep my hob?Upkeep varies by type; however, typically, it includes routine cleansing, inspecting for damage, and ensuring that burners or elements are working properly.
